Average Cost of Solar Panels in Grattan

Let's have a look at the average cost of solar panels in Grattan.

Currently, the national average cost of solar panels is $2.66 per watt. However, in Grattan, the typical cost of a solar system is 2.81 per watt. Because a 6.2-kW system is needed to cover the energy consumption of a typical home in Grattan, the average price of going solar will be about $12,156 after claiming the federal solar tax credit of 30%.

Keep in mind that the numbers above are only averages. The price you'll end up paying for solar may vary based on your household energy use, the type of solar panels you choose, your solar contractor and more. With average savings of about $21,000 on utility bills over 20 years, many homeowners in Grattan find installing solar panels can pay off big.

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Grattan

Cost is usually one of the most important factors for homeowners who want to invest in solar. There are a few key factors that will push your cost above or below the average in Grattan: solar equipment and system size, financing options and the solar installation company you choose. We'll go over each of these briefly below.

Solar Equipment

One of the most important factors to consider when it comes to the cost of adopting solar energy is the size of the solar system, which is measured in kilowatts (kW). The more power your household uses, the larger your system will likely need to be. You can expect to spend around $2,810 per kilowatt in Grattan. The model of solar panels and equipment you get is another factor that will largely influence costs. Solar panels that have higher efficiency, like monocrystalline panels, tend to be more expensive. Moreover, solar equipment goes beyond just the solar panels themselves. You'll also need to make decisions about the kind of racks used to mount the panels, inverters, solar batteries, etc. It's important to take all of this into consideration when searching for a solar system that's in your budget.

Solar Financing Terms

Many homeowners find the average cost of solar in Grattan to be too steep, even if the investment pays off over time. Thankfully, nearly every solar installer in the area provides financing options. Solar loans remarkably decrease upfront costs for most homeowners, but they also lead to paying more over time due to interest. You'll have to consider the long-term cost of financing options, including the total interest you'll pay over the length of the loan. If you're only able to get a high-interest loan, then your total can be hundreds or even thousands of dollars above the equipment and labor cost. Making a larger down payment or getting a solar loan with a low APR could reduce your costs remarkably.

Solar Panel Installation Company

The solar installer you hire to handle your switch to sustainable energy can play a part in your total costs. There are about 3 solar panel companies operating in Grattan, and each can charge different amounts for labor and equipment. The company's size sometimes plays the most significant role in the cost. Larger national companies, like SunPro and Sunrun, often have lower prices due to access to more resources and better pricing. Smaller local companies might be more costly, but they generally have better customer service and more customization options, and the occasional sale or discount can bring their pricing lower to compete with bigger companies.

Solar Panel Cost Data by System Size

System size Cost per system watt Solar system cost 25-Year savings Payback period
6 kW $2.92 $12,274 $21,160 9.2 years
8 kW $2.87 $16,051 $28,527 9.0 years
10 kW $2.81 $19,670 $36,053 8.8 years
12 kW $2.75 $23,132 $43,735 8.6 years
14 kW $2.70 $26,436 $51,575 8.5 years
16 kW $2.64 $29,584 $59,573 8.3 years
18 kW $2.59 $32,574 $67,727 8.1 years
20 kW $2.53 $35,406 $76,039 7.9 years

How to Save on Solar Panels

Since the brand of solar panels and the installer you choose greatly impacts your costs and your system's durability and efficiency, it's important to pick the right ones for you. Here are some things to keep in mind to help with your decision:

  • Installation Process: When making the switch to solar energy, it's essential to keep an open line of communication with your solar installer. Confirm that you understand how the installation process works and the project completion timeline.
  • Reputation: Solar installers that have great reviews from their customers and that have been operating for many years in most cases provide high-quality solar panel installation and expertise.
  • Contract: It's important to look over your solar installer's contract thoroughly to understand what services they will provide, what the warranty covers and what you can expect about the installation process.
  • Solar Panel Brands: Each solar panel brand and kind offers varying levels of quality, durability and energy efficiency. They will come at different prices as well. The company you choose plays a role in which solar panel brands you have access to.

Is going solar worth it?

Solar panels can be a good investment for lots of homeowners, but they might not be worth it for everyone. If your home doesn't get a lot of direct sunlight and/or your energy bills are already reasonably low, solar panels might not be for you.

How long do solar panels last in Grattan?

Even though the average lifespan of solar panels is 25 to 30 years, that doesn't mean they stop working completely at that time. What this means is how much energy they produce will have decreased significantly after that point. You can replace them after having them for that long or you can keep using them at a lower efficiency.
